Okay, this is my LAST ADR decision to make before we are 100% set.

We are doing Donald's Safari Breakfast at AK.

We can do 8:40AM or 10:00AM. We are staying at the POP and could drive if we need to.

I worry about my family dragging for 8:40 and missing the rope drop show while eating.

If we did 10:00, after rope drop would we have time to ride something or grab a FP before breakfast?

I don't want to walk out of Tusker at 11:00am in the middle of crowds with long lines ahead having done nothing with no FP in hand.

This is our 1st trip so I don't know how close things are to each other. BTW, it will be a green TGM day.

Thanks!
 
If you arrive at the park at opening, you should have plenty of time to hit a couple attractions before breakfast. I suggest keeping the 10 a.m. reservation. By the time you finish the 8:40 meal, the lines at the major rides like Expedition Everest may already be fairly long.

As an aside, I love the breakfast at Tusker House. It's my favorite character meal.
 
I would take the 10am slot and be at the park at rope drop. Once you enter the park, have 1 family member go to EE and get fast passes then meet up at the Safari which won't be very busy yet and the animals will just have arrived. By the time you are done with the Safari and the Forrest trail it will be time for breakfast.
